A day after cricketer turned politician Navjot Sidhu resigned as Rajya Sabha MP amid speculations of him joining the Aam Aadmi Party, wife of suspended BJP lawmaker Kirti Azad, Poonam Azad is set to follow suit.

According to sources, Poonam Azad who had been a three-time party national executive member took the decision of quitting the BJP in the backdrop of her husband who had attacked union finance minister Arun Jaitley over alleged corruption in DDCA during the latter's tenure as its head and continued with his tirade despite party chief Amit Shah's intervention. "She was also distanced from the BJP by the top brass of the party," said a party source.

Poonam's decision triggered speculations over Kirti Azad quitting the BJP and joining the AAP, there was no official confirmation on the same.

Top AAP sources said once she formally joins the party, she will be campaigning in the Bihari-dominated localities of Punjab, ahead of the state assembly elections there. Political observers said that she could be AAP's face for Bihar as well in the future.

Even Sidhu will be a strong contender for AAP chief ministerial face in Punjab, even though he had declined commenting on or confirming any such development.
